- Day 2: Tel Aviv – Caesarea – Haifa – Rosh HaNikra – Nazareth
Drive north along Israel’s Mediterranean coast on your Israel Biblical Tour, stopping at Caesarea, an ancient Roman city with a stunning amphitheater and aqueducts. Continue to Haifa to marvel at the terraced Baha’i Gardens, a UNESCO World Heritage Site, and learn about the Baha’i faith. Explore the spectacular Rosh HaNikra Grottoes, formed by sea waves cutting into the chalk cliffs, and later visit Acre, a fortified Crusader city full of history. End your day in Nazareth, checking into your hotel and preparing for the biblical journey ahead.
Highlights: Caesarea Roman Amphitheater & Aqueducts, Haifa Baha’i Gardens, Rosh HaNikra Grottoes, Acre Crusader Fortifications

- Day 3: Nazareth – Mount of Beatitudes – Capernaum – Sea of Galilee
Visit the Church of the Annunciation in Nazareth on your Israel Biblical Tour, where tradition holds that the angel Gabriel appeared to Mary. Travel to the Mount of Beatitudes for breathtaking views of the Sea of Galilee and reflect on the Sermon on the Mount. Explore Capernaum, known as the town of Jesus’ ministry, including the ruins of the ancient synagogue. End your day at Tabgha, the site of the Multiplication of Loaves and Fish, a key biblical event.
Highlights: Church of the Annunciation, Mount of Beatitudes, Sea of Galilee Views, Capernaum Synagogue, Tabgha Church of Multiplication

- Day 5: Nazareth – Banias – Kibbutz – Golan Antiquities Museum
Start the day at Banias, an archaeological site with waterfalls and ancient ruins of a Roman city dedicated to Pan. Visit a local kibbutz to learn about Israel’s communal lifestyle. Explore Katzrin, a reconstructed Jewish village from the Talmudic era, and visit the Golan Antiquities Museum to see artifacts from the region. Conclude the day at Mt. Bental, a former Syrian bunker offering panoramic views and insight into the Six-Day War. This day adds depth and cultural context to your Israel Biblical Tour.
Highlights: Banias Waterfalls & Ruins, Kibbutz Experience, Katzrin Ancient Village, Golan Antiquities Museum, Mt. Bental Views

- Day 6: Dead Sea – Qumran – Masada – Ein Gedi – Jerusalem
Travel south to the Dead Sea, the lowest point on Earth, as part of your Israel Biblical Tour. Visit Qumran, where the Dead Sea Scrolls were discovered. Ascend Masada, an ancient fortress with dramatic desert views, via cable car, and learn about the heroic story of the Jewish Zealots. Stop at Ein Gedi, a lush desert oasis with hiking trails, waterfalls, and wildlife. Relax by floating in the mineral-rich Dead Sea, enjoying its therapeutic waters and mud before heading to Jerusalem.
Highlights: Dead Sea Floating & Mud, Qumran Scrolls, Masada Fortress, Ein Gedi Oasis, Desert Views
